(Main)Aerospace series - Steel - Forging stock and forgings - Technical specification - Part 2: Forging stock
Aerospace series - Steel - Forging stock and forgings - Technical specification - Part 2: Forging stock
The present standard specifies the particular requirements for forging stock intended for the manufacture of steel forgings. This standard shall be used in conjunction with EN 2157-1. Bars and sections conforming to EN 2069-3 may be used as forgings stock provided that an agreement was established between the forging stock manufacturer and the purchaser to ensure that the requirements of the present standard are met.
